When it comes to games, AI has been utilized to create more realistic and intelligent non-player characters (NPCs) that can provide players with a more immersive gaming experience. These AI-controlled characters can adapt to different strategies used by players, making the gameplay more dynamic and unpredictable. On the other hand, games can also be used as a tool to study artificial intelligence. Researchers often use games as a testing ground for AI algorithms, training them to perform specific tasks or solve complex problems. By competing against human players or other AI agents in games, researchers can evaluate the performance and capabilities of different AI models. The Assyrians were an ancient civilization that thrived in the region of Mesopotamia, present-day Iraq, in the first millennium BC. Known for their military prowess and innovative technologies, the Assyrians left a lasting impact on the ancient world. The Assyrians were among the first to develop advanced siege warfare techniques, using battering rams, siege towers, and tunnels to conquer fortified cities. They also made significant advancements in the field of mathematics, astronomy, and architecture, leaving behind impressive monuments and achievements.
